Through this petition under Section 482 Cr.P.C., prayer has been made for quashing FIR No. 161 dated 15.08.2018 (Annexure P-1) registered under Section 379(b) IPC at Police Station Lalru, District SAS Nagar (Mohali) and all subsequent proceedings arising therefrom, on the basis of compromise dated 23.05.2018 (Annexure P-2), effected between the parties.

2.

Vakalatnama filed on behalf of respondent No. 2 is taken on record. Office to tag the same at the appropriate place. 3.

Vide order dated 18.07.2018, the parties were directed to appear before the trial Court/Illaqa Magistrate, to get their statements recorded for compromise with a direction to the trial Court/Illaqa Magistrate, to furnish a report qua veracity of the compromise. 4.

CRM-M-29825-2018 -2and Sessions Judge, SAS Nagar (Mohali) and got recorded their statements qua compromise on 18.08.2018. Report from the Additional District and Sessions Judge, SAS Nagar (Mohali), vide letter No. 132 dated 23.08.2018, duly forwarded by the District and Sessions Judge, SAS Nagar, vide Endst. No. 8696 dated 27.08.2018 has been received. According to the report of the Additional District and Sessions Judge, SAS Nagar (Mohali), the compromise has been effected between the parties voluntarily. 5.

In view of the totality of the facts and circumstances and considering the fact that the compromise will bring harmony and peace in relations between the parties, this petition is allowed and the aforesaid, FIR No. 161 dated 15.08.2018 (Annexure P-1) and all subsequent proceedings arising therefrom, qua the petitioners are quashed, subject to payment of costs of `10,000/-, out of which `8,000/- shall be deposited with the following account:- Account details:- Chief Minister's Distress Relief Fund.
